Manchester United place eye to sign 22-year-old Dutch professional footballer this summer
Manchester United wants to add another striker to their team to go with Rasmus Hojlund, and a deal is almost complete.
And Sir Jim Ratcliffe is about to make an offer on a top forward in Europe. This means that Manchester United need to get another striker.
At times this season, the Red Devils have had trouble scoring goals, and Rasmus Hojlund has been having a tough time getting used to the Premier League. The Danish player started the season hurt and didn’t score for a long time before he found his groove.
Hojlund has finally become good, but there isn’t a lot of quality behind the young player, so Manchester United are allegedly looking to add some good players in the attacking areas.
soocer442 says that Joshua Zirkzee, a talented Dutch forward, “knows that he will play in England sooner or later” and that Manchester United will soon make a public offer to bring him to the country.
The star player for Bologna is likely to leave Italy for about €50 million. Arsenal and Bayern Munich are also said to be interested. However, FFT thinks that United have more important problems to deal with than the front three. Zirkzee’s rising value may make it too expensive for him to move to Old Trafford.
For the 22-year-old to leave Bologna this summer, there may be more than one offer.
